Oakridge Global Energy Solutions To Create 1,000 Jobs in Brevard County, FL

Oakridge Global Energy Solutions will expand in Brevard County, FL creating 1,000 jobs and a $270 million capital investment. Oakridge Global Energy Solutions is an energy storage solutions company that develops and manufactures batteries and power systems.

In September, Oakridge Global Energy Solutions completed moving its corporate headquarters into a new 68,718-square-foot facility in Palm Bay. The new facility provides Oakridge with the space to install additional manufacturing equipment, increase production, and continue delivering American-made products. The company currently employs 36 Floridians.

Florida is home to more than 18,600 manufacturing companies. The state’s more than 321,000 manufacturing employees produce a wide variety of goods including aerospace products, batteries, food and beverages, communications equipment, pharmaceuticals, semiconductors, boats and more.
